Enjoy a 75-minute self-drive tour through Berlin in a retro-style Trabant. Following a guide, squeeze yourself behind the wheel of your own Trabi to explore the German capital in a unique way. You'll see sights such as Potsdamer Platz and the Brandenburg Gate, and receive a souvenir Trabant driver's license at the end of the tour. Select a morning or afternoon tour when booking.

- Minimum age is 18 years
- Children up to 17 years accompanied by at least one adult are free of charge
- Evidence of a driver's license for non-automatic cars is required from all drivers
- Maximum weight per vehicle is 770 lbs (350 kg)
- Maximum people per vehicle is 4
- Any child seats, if necessary, must be provided by the customer
- In the case of an accident, the local tour operator will require a co-payment of EUR 850
